Hubbard Lake covers 8,850 acres and is seven miles long (north-south) and two miles wide. It has a maximum depth of 85 feet with an average depth of 32.6 feet. The lake spans three townships: Caledonia, Alcona, and Hawes. This lake is known for its excellent bass, trout, walleye and yellow perch fishing and as a winter ice-fishing spot.
